I have added an Orbi system to my network in AP mode to replace an ASUS RT-68P, but miss much of the diagnostic info I've been accustomed to.
On the attached devices screen in AP mode, I would like to know the current tx/rx speed of the devices, which band they are using, as well as whether they are on the router or which satellite.
I'd also like to be able to see the MAC addresses of the wifi interfaces in the GUI so I can determine which router/satellite is connected from a wifi client system
